Sey Ha SokSey Ha Sok
After taking a year-long break, I found myself back at Malis, and it was as comforting as ever. I went with the tamarind soup and grilled beef, which were fresh and tangy in all the right ways. The beef was tender and tasty, though I wouldn’t have minded a bit more char for that perfect smoky edge. There was also a funny little moment when I first walked in. I spoke in English, and the first staff member greeted me in English as well. But then, I overheard one of her colleagues tell her, “Just greet him in Khmer.” After that, we switched to Khmer, and it felt like they were happy to fully welcome a fellow Khmer speaker. I need to work on my undercover skills.
ArmandArmand
I'm not super familiar with Vietnamese food, and the lady running the store was most helpful helping me pick out the vegetarian dishes, of which there are at least 5 to choose from. I had the "Chinese Plain Macaroni with Egg" and enjoyed it a lot! Great vegetarian option. Someone I was with had the Green beef curry and also enjoyed it. We were able to get in and eat here despite one of us using a wheelchair. The shop is accessible with step-free access. The shop is on the first floor, but there is a fairly wide elevator there.
